Koalas are both endangered and so plentiful they're causing problems. How'd that happen?

Saturday, June 10, 2023 - 08:22 in Biology & Nature

They are a poster child for imminent extinction, at risk from deforestation, climate change and bushfires. Yet, where I live in South Australia, they are so abundant they are in danger of eating themselves out of house and home.
